When we first arrived, we thought the hotel was a little out of the way out of the town, but we did walk in - it took about 20 minutes and as Novogrudok is such a pretty town, it was actually a pleasure to walk past all the colourful houses and locals. Another option is to catch the local bus or a taxi. We were travelling with family - 8 adults. We had 3 rooms between us. Breakfast was pre-booked and menu chosen the night before and it was very good. The two ladies at reception were so lovely. Even though there was a language barrier Russian/English, we were able to communicate quite well with the use of a translate app on our phones. The receptionists helped to organise our bus trip back to Minsk, and even requested that the bus pick us up from the hotel, which was a bonus. As we did not go out for dinner, we were able to use the breakfast room to bring our food in and enjoy. Our rooms were simple, but clean and comfortable. Shower was good. We were on the first floor and it was easy to take our bags up.I would recommend staying here if you ever go to Novogrudok.…
